Output 759052113327996a2bc41e5f1fc566d9ff6eecba8c6520765f995021607fe1ea:0

value
618379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5546d34602ba88231efc52eee2863adaf1a791a1 OP_EQUAL
address
2N128Gcj1Pbv7qgL4VUsLfqBTrs5uvcELUp
transaction
759052113327996a2bc41e5f1fc566d9ff6eecba8c6520765f995021607fe1ea
spent
true